2015-02-28 |
Benjamin Kramer | Replace std::copy with a back inserter with vector... |
tree | commitdiff |
2015-02-27 |
Benjamin Kramer | MachineDominators: Move applySplitCriticalEdges into... |
tree | commitdiff |
2015-02-27 |
Benjamin Kramer | Reduce double set lookups. |
tree | commitdiff |
2015-02-27 |
Eric Christopher | Remove the Forward Control Flow Integrity pass and... |
tree | commitdiff |
2015-02-27 |
Mehdi Amini | Change the fast-isel-abort option from bool to int... |
tree | commitdiff |
2015-02-27 |
Rafael Espindola | Centralize handling of the eh_begin and eh_end labels. |
tree | commitdiff |
2015-02-27 |
Sanjoy Das | Don't modify the DenseMap being iterated over from... |
tree | commitdiff |
2015-02-27 |
Eric Christopher | Rewrite MachineOperand::print and MachineInstr::print... |
tree | commitdiff |
2015-02-26 |
Rafael Espindola | Put jump tables in distinct sections if -ffunction... |
tree | commitdiff |
2015-02-26 |
Eric Christopher | Remove DebugLoc::print(LLVMContext, raw_ostream), it... |
tree | commitdiff |
2015-02-26 |
Eric Christopher | getRegForInlineAsmConstraint wants to use TargetRegiste... |
tree | commitdiff |
2015-02-26 |
Eric Christopher | Add a TargetMachine argument to the AddressingModeMatch... |
tree | commitdiff |
2015-02-26 |
Rafael Espindola | Simplify arange output. |
tree | commitdiff |
2015-02-26 |
Paul Robinson | When the source has a series of assignments, users... |
tree | commitdiff |
2015-02-26 |
Eric Christopher | Remove an argument-less call to getSubtargetImpl from... |
tree | commitdiff |
2015-02-25 |
Eric Christopher | Move TargetLoweringBase::getTypeConversion to the ... |
tree | commitdiff |
2015-02-25 |
Andrew Kaylor | Fixing a problem with insert location in WinEH outlining |
tree | commitdiff |
2015-02-25 |
Rafael Espindola | Support SHF_MERGE sections in COMDATs. |
tree | commitdiff |
2015-02-24 |
David Majnemer | PrologEpilogInserter: Clean up math in calculateFrameOb... |
tree | commitdiff |
2015-02-24 |
Simon Pilgrim | Reapplied D7816 & rL230177 & rL230278 - with an additio... |
tree | commitdiff |
2015-02-24 |
Andrew Kaylor | Fixing eol-style |
tree | commitdiff |
2015-02-24 |
Eric Christopher | Revert: |
tree | commitdiff |
2015-02-24 |
Eric Christopher | Rename UpdateRegAllocHint to match style guidelines. |
tree | commitdiff |
2015-02-24 |
Matthias Braun | DAGCombiner: Move variable definitions closer to use... |
tree | commitdiff |
2015-02-24 |
Matthias Braun | DAGCombiner: Move variable declaration closer to defini... |
tree | commitdiff |
2015-02-24 |
Tim Northover | ARM: treat [N x i32] and [N x i64] as AAPCS composite... |
tree | commitdiff |
2015-02-24 |
Hal Finkel | [SDAG] Handle LowerOperation returning its input consis... |
tree | commitdiff |
2015-02-23 |
Simon Pilgrim | Fix based on post-commit comment on D7816 & rL230177... |
tree | commitdiff |
2015-02-23 |
Andrea Di Biagio | [X86] Teach how to custom lower double-to-half conversi... |
tree | commitdiff |
2015-02-23 |
Bruno Cardoso Lopes | [AsmPrinter] Access pointers to globals via pcrel GOT... |
tree | commitdiff |
2015-02-23 |
Andrew Kaylor | Removing unused private field. |
tree | commitdiff |
2015-02-23 |
Andrew Kaylor | Second attempt to fix WinEHCatchDirector build failures. |
tree | commitdiff |
2015-02-23 |
Andrew Kaylor | Attempting to fix WinEHCatchDirector destructor related... |
tree | commitdiff |
2015-02-23 |
Andrew Kaylor | Remap frame variables for native Windows exception... |
tree | commitdiff |
2015-02-23 |
Eric Christopher | Rewrite the global merge pass to be subprogram agnostic... |
tree | commitdiff |
2015-02-22 |
Simon Pilgrim | [DagCombiner] Generalized BuildVector Vector Concatenation |
tree | commitdiff |
2015-02-22 |
Hal Finkel | [DAGCombine] Don't assume integer-type legailty in... |
tree | commitdiff |
2015-02-22 |
Hal Finkel | [SDAG] Use correct alignments on expanded vector trunc... |
tree | commitdiff |
2015-02-21 |
Benjamin Kramer | MachineInstr: Use range-based for loops. NFC. |
tree | commitdiff |
2015-02-21 |
Benjamin Kramer | Calling memmove on a MachineOperand is totally safe. |
tree | commitdiff |
2015-02-21 |
Eric Christopher | Unconditionally create a new MCInstrInfo in the asm... |
tree | commitdiff |
2015-02-21 |
David Majnemer | X86: Call __main using the SelectionDAG |
tree | commitdiff |
2015-02-20 |
Matthias Braun | LiveRangeCalc: Don't start liveranges of PHI instructio... |
tree | commitdiff |
2015-02-20 |
Rafael Espindola | Use short names for jumptable sections. |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Used the cached subtarget off of the MachineFunction. |
tree | commitdiff |
2015-02-20 |
Matt Arsenault | Add generic fmad DAG node. |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Grab the DataLayout off of the TargetMachine since... |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Get the function specific subtarget. |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Get the cached subtarget off the MachineFunction rather... |
tree | commitdiff |
2015-02-20 |
Igor Laevsky | Generalize statepoint lowering to use ImmutableStatepoi... |
tree | commitdiff |
2015-02-20 |
Nick Lewycky | Fix build with gcc. This has a -Wsequence-point error... |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Remove more uses of TargetMachine::getSubtargetImpl... |
tree | commitdiff |
2015-02-20 |
Eric Christopher | AsmPrinter::doFinalization is at the module level and... |
tree | commitdiff |
2015-02-20 |
Eric Christopher | Remove the MCInstrInfo cached variable as it was only... |
tree | commitdiff |
2015-02-20 |
Chandler Carruth | Revert r229944: EH: Prune unreachable resume instructio... |
tree | commitdiff |
2015-02-20 |
Reid Kleckner | EH: Prune unreachable resume instructions during Dwarf... |
tree | commitdiff |
2015-02-20 |
Eric Christopher | This needs to be a const variable so the two sides... |
tree | commitdiff |
2015-02-19 |
Eric Christopher | Only use the initialized MCInstrInfo if it's been initi... |
tree | commitdiff |
2015-02-19 |
Eric Christopher | Migrate away a use of the subtarget (and TargetMachine... |
tree | commitdiff |
2015-02-19 |
Ahmed Bougacha | [CodeGen] Use ArrayRef instead of std::vector&. NFC. |
tree | commitdiff |
2015-02-19 |
Eric Christopher | MCTargetOptions reside on the TargetMachine that we... |
tree | commitdiff |
2015-02-19 |
Eric Christopher | Remove a call to TargetMachine::getSubtarget from the... |
tree | commitdiff |
2015-02-19 |
Eric Christopher | Remove unused argument from emitInlineAsmStart. |
tree | commitdiff |
2015-02-19 |
Eric Christopher | Update and remove a few calls to TargetMachine::getSubt... |
tree | commitdiff |
2015-02-19 |
Benjamin Kramer | Demote vectors to arrays. No functionality change. |
tree | commitdiff |
2015-02-19 |
Chandler Carruth | [x86,sdag] Two interrelated changes to the x86 and... |
tree | commitdiff |
2015-02-18 |
Reid Kleckner | Add an IR-to-IR test for dwarf EH preparation using opt |
tree | commitdiff |
2015-02-18 |
Andrew Kaylor | Style and formatting fixes for r229715 |
tree | commitdiff |
2015-02-18 |
Reid Kleckner | dos2unix the WinEH file and tests |
tree | commitdiff |
2015-02-18 |
David Blaikie | Remove unused member variables (-Wunused-private-field) |
tree | commitdiff |
2015-02-18 |
Andrew Kaylor | Adding implementation to outline C++ catch handlers... |
tree | commitdiff |
2015-02-18 |
Michael Kuperstein | Fixes two issue in SimplifyDemandedBits of sext_in_reg: |
tree | commitdiff |
2015-02-18 |
Daniel Jasper | NFC: Use range-based for loops and more consistent... |
tree | commitdiff |
2015-02-18 |
Daniel Jasper | Remove experimental options to control machine block... |
tree | commitdiff |
2015-02-18 |
Matthias Braun | LiveRangeCalc: Rename some parameters from kill to... |
tree | commitdiff |
2015-02-17 |
Rafael Espindola | Twines should be passed by const ref. |
tree | commitdiff |
2015-02-17 |
Rafael Espindola | Add r228939 back with a fix. |
tree | commitdiff |
2015-02-17 |
Duncan P. N. Exon... | AsmPrinter: Take range in DwarfExpression::AddExpressio... |
tree | commitdiff |
2015-02-17 |
Rafael Espindola | Add r228980 back. |
tree | commitdiff |
2015-02-17 |
Eric Christopher | Make the ARM AsmPrinter independent of global subtarget |
tree | commitdiff |
2015-02-17 |
Eric Christopher | 80-column fixups. |
tree | commitdiff |
2015-02-17 |
Sanjay Patel | Canonicalize splats as build_vectors (PR22283) |
tree | commitdiff |
2015-02-17 |
Benjamin Kramer | Prefer SmallVector::append/insert over push_back loops. |
tree | commitdiff |
2015-02-17 |
Duncan P. N. Exon... | AsmPrinter: Use DIExpression default constructor, NFC |
tree | commitdiff |
2015-02-17 |
Duncan P. N. Exon... | AsmPrinter: Stop creating DebugLocs |
tree | commitdiff |
2015-02-16 |
Matthias Braun | RegisterCoalescer: Don't rematerialize subregister... |
tree | commitdiff |
2015-02-16 |
Matthias Braun | RegisterCoalescer: Do not look for regclass of IMPLICIT... |
tree | commitdiff |
2015-02-16 |
Mehdi Amini | SelectionDAG: fold (fp_to_u/sint (s/uint_to_fp)) here too |
tree | commitdiff |
2015-02-16 |
Matthias Braun | RegisterCoalescer: Improve previous fix for wrong def... |
tree | commitdiff |
2015-02-16 |
Aaron Ballman | MSVC 2013 supports std::forward_as_tuple, while MSVC... |
tree | commitdiff |
2015-02-16 |
Andrew Trick | AArch64: Safely handle the incoming sret call argument. |
tree | commitdiff |
2015-02-16 |
Michael Kuperstein | Fix quoting of #pragma comment for MS compat, LLVM... |
tree | commitdiff |
2015-02-15 |
Aaron Ballman | Removing LLVM_DELETED_FUNCTION, as MSVC 2012 was the... |
tree | commitdiff |
2015-02-15 |
Chandler Carruth | [SDAG] Teach the SelectionDAG to canonicalize vector... |
tree | commitdiff |
2015-02-15 |
Chandler Carruth | [x86] Fix PR22377, a regression with the new vector... |
tree | commitdiff |
2015-02-14 |
Duncan P. N. Exon... | CodeGen: Canonicalize access to function attributes... |
tree | commitdiff |
2015-02-14 |
Matthias Braun | Revert "On ELF, put PIC jump tables in a non executable... |
tree | commitdiff |
2015-02-14 |
Reid Kleckner | Unify the two EH personality classification routines... |
tree | commitdiff |
2015-02-13 |
Andrea Di Biagio | [CodeGenPrepare] Removed duplicate logic. SimplifyCFG... |
tree | commitdiff |
2015-02-13 |
Arnaud A. de Grand... | [PBQP] Conservativelly allocatable nodes can be spilled... |
tree | commitdiff |
next |